The extradition process of Mexican drug lord Joaquín 'El Chapo' Guzmán to the U.S. began after his recapture. Initially, President Enrique Peña Nieto opposed extradition, but changed stance post-recapture. Guzmán faces drug trafficking charges in several U.S. districts. The process involves the Fiscalía presenting evidence, followed by judicial and Cancillería approvals. El Chapo was recaptured in Sinaloa after a military operation, following a dramatic escape through underground tunnels.
